Hot off the press is the lineup for both Ibiza and Mallorca Rocks for 2011. With Plan B set to kick off proceedings with back to back gigs in Mallorca (Tues 31st May) and Ibiza (Wed 1st June), a whole host of Europe's hottest acts will be hitting Ibiza and Mallorca over a 17 week long summer series of unmissable live gigs.

Ibiza Rocks returns for another smashing summer season, 5 years running and this year's lineup is one of the best to date including Pete Doherty, Biffy Clyro, The Prodigy, Ian Brown, Calvin Harris, Florence and the Machine and many many more.
